From: Zebrafish xenograft model for studying mechanism and treatment of non-small cell lung cancer brain metastasis

Fig. 1

Establishment of zebrafish NSCLC BM xenograft models. (A) Schematic diagram of imaging and collecting zebrafish brain. The zebrafish brain was imaged from vertical view (blue arrow) and excised (red dotted box) to extract RNA. (B) The schematic diagram showed zebrafish embryos at 2 dpf. The red dots indicated cancer cells injected into the perivitelline space (PVs). (C) Images of brain at different developmental stages of Tg (fli-1: EGFP) zebrafish (2-6 dpf). The white short dashed line indicated the midbrain of the zebrafish, and the white long dashed line indicated the zebrafish’s eyes and hindbrain. (D) The expression of claudin-5 in the zebrafish brain at different developmental stages (2-7 dpf). (E) The expression of mfsd2aa and mfsd2ab in the zebrafish brain at different developmental stages (2-6 dpf). (F) Survival curves of 2 dpf zebrafish with different tumor-bearing amount in PVs. About 50-400 H1975 cells (red fluorescence) were injected into the PVs of 2 dpf zebrafish, and the number of deaths was counted till 8 dpi. (G-I) Three human NSCLC cell lines were involved: H1975, A549 and H1299. About 100 cells were injected into the PVs of zebrafish at different developmental stages, and the brain of zebrafish was imaged at 1 dpi. The white arrows indicated cancer cells in blood vessels of zebrafish brain. (J-K) Quantification of the BM cells number in zebrafish at 1 dpi. Significance was considered when P values were lower than 0.05. (ns) indicated statistical insignificance, (*) indicated statistical significance P < 0.05, (**) P < 0.01 and (***) P < 0.001. dpf: days post fertilization, dpi: days post injection
